

The four leveling zones can be done on your journey to 110, but Good Suramaritan can only be completed at 110 - and will require a SIGNIFICANT time investment to complete. This means you’ll have to complete an entire zone on one character to get credit. The achievement is account wide, but progress on the sub achievements is per character. To unlock this achievement you need to complete all of the main story quests within each of the five Broken Isles zones. This one is pretty simple: Explore all of the zones. This umbrella achievement comprises a similar set of objective to those found in the Pathfinder from WoD.

We don’t have a definitive list of everything that will be required to unlock flying, but we can be fairly confident that “Broken Isles Pathfinder, Part One” will be required.
